Debts

One big change is that you can now have debts. (type eb:info)
This is a mix of “we can’t set all your unpaid structures to the HWS faction or do it manually” and again a lesson to be friendly to the performance of the game / server.
If you have debts you need obviously to pay it back first to be able to use your bank credits. With “pay back” I mean to just earn bank credits so it will be transferred automatically.

Improvements

One thing people tried to do or questioned: public structures can now be tracked and count also as taxed structures.
As we said often: it is not a good idea to set them to public.

The update was one day live before you even responded. It is working as it should after checking different players, different scenarios.

It depends. If the ship was before set to private and you make it public it counts as private (we know who changed it, so it will be in YOUR tax list). If the ship was before to faction and you change it to public then it will be in the tax list for everybody in the faction.

So to sum it up again:
Taxes were an idea by me to get rid of Peacekeepers. Peacekeepers where permanent PvE playfields in HWS 1-3. These playfields got full after some time over and over again and we had to implement new Peacekeeper playfields over and over again. That caused more and more problems because currently Empyrion works like this:
100 people in ONE playfield = cool
30 people in DIFFERENT playfields = dead
So in HWS 4.0 I wanted to test this and sensitize people once again that Empyrion is NOT “Minecraft” (it is an acronym for me to explain too massive hang for building stuff)
It would be the same as if we hadn’t implemented tax in HWS 4.0 but we would say you only have 4 Peacekeeper Planets and some people will be wiped from there after some time. But this wouldn’t be so cool you can imagine.

Last but not least the Tax system has a lot more potential. For example a faction bank, event based tax payments, transfer taxes etc. It is just the beginning and supports overall the role play character I was looking for (trading, pirating, defending, etc.)
